Meerut, Feb. 21 -- A 14-year-old Dalit girl allegedly died by suicide on February 18 in Uttar Pradesh after her 25-year-old molester was released on bail and then threatened to kill her.

A First Information Report (FIR) was registered under Section 108 (abetment of suicide) of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ita and Section 3(2)(v) (uses words, acts or gestures of a sexual nature towards SC/ST woman) of the Scheduled Caste/Scheduled Tribes (Prevention of Atrocities) Act.

The accused, Lavlesh Kumar, was sent to jail on Friday, February 20.

The young girl took her own life while her parents were away. Upon returning to their home in Lakhimpur Kheri, near Meerut, they discovered her body hanging from the roof.
